Rising Tide Charters LLC
Rising Tide Charters LLC heißt Sie in Avalon, New Jersey von Mai bis November und in Ft Pierce, Florida von Ende November bis Mai willkommen. Wir versprechen Ihnen, dass Ihr Tag auf dem Wasser unvergesslich wird. Kapitän Scott Brown nimmt Sie mit zum Angeln entlang der Küste, in Küstennähe sowie auf die Hochsee und wird sein Bestes tun, um Ihren Ausflug unterhaltsam und erfolgreich zu gestalten.
Ihr Abenteuer beginnt auf einer 34 Fuß langen, maßgefertigten Jarrett Bay Walk-Around-Yacht, die bis zu 6 Angler sicher aufnehmen kann. Die Yacht wird von zwei 350 PS starken Yamaha-Motoren angetrieben und nutzt alle erforderlichen Navigationselektronik, um eine schnelle und sichere Fahrt zu den Fischen zu gewährleisten. Das Boot verfügt über eine Toilette, Heizung und Klimaanlage sowie ein Bett für Ihren Komfort.
Zu den Arten, die Sie auf Ihrem Ausflug gezielt beangeln können, gehören Marlin, Thunfisch, Goldmakrele (Mahi Mahi), Tarpun, Schnapper und mehr. Sie werden Grundangeln, Big-Game-Angeln, Trolling, Spinnfischen, Jigging, Popping sowie Driftfischen mit leichtem und schwerem Angelgerät ausprobieren, um diese begehrten Fische einzuholen.
Kapitän Scott stellt Ihnen alle Angelruten, Rollen, Angelgerät, Köder und Angellizenzen zur Verfügung, die Sie für Ihren Ausflug benötigen. Kinder sind herzlich willkommen an Bord und Sie können entscheiden, ob Sie die gefangenen Fische behalten möchten, da Kapitän Scott sie für Sie säubert und filetiert
. Alles, was Sie mitbringen müssen, sind etwas Essen und Getränke, um während des Ausflugs bei Kräften zu bleiben.
